Regular
eye examinations are an essential part of eye health. They assess the
level of your vision and check the health of each eye. Examinations
can detect changes in your eyes and help to identify problems at an
early stage.

We recommend that all adults undergo an eye examination
every two years and that those under 16 or over 70 do so every year.
If your work requires that you are “regularly using a terminal
for spells of one hour or more” you may be able to ask your
employer to pay for your eye examination and contribute towards the
cost of
any glasses that you may need to use. This includes computer monitors
and
shop tills. Please enquire for more details.
This examination analyses the vision
of each eye, checking for conditions such as long or short
sightedness, and
presbyiopia – old
sightedness. The health of your eyes is also examined to identify
any changes since your previous test and to help rectify any problems.
During
this brief, painless and comfortable procedure you will be asked a
few questions about your medical history as this information helps
us to
assess correctly the performance of your eyes. You will then be asked
to respond
to a range of visual stimuli, including the familiar reading letters
of gradually reducing size.
